Transaction 12a513ed998cbecea4fb106589bfd8b7e74f40de89bcce1b0ec03d486a74642e
1 Input
2 Outputs
- 12a513ed998cbecea4fb106589bfd8b7e74f40de89bcce1b0ec03d486a74642e:0
- 12a513ed998cbecea4fb106589bfd8b7e74f40de89bcce1b0ec03d486a74642e:1
value 29612132
address 13MWn4Z8TzqtFCgWVSSJzMf8uPSAHe1kue
value 59000000
address 19TFPAreVS6XcKsYha3Mks66qtGmCwN3FS